The delay stems from integration defects discovered during the Pellam depot pilot and from staffing gaps on the migration team. Remediation is underway: two additional engineers have joined from the Ashgrove branch, and the revised cutover sequence prioritizes the three highest-volume depots. Managers should hold current timelines in staff communications until the review concludes. Context on downstream planning follows in the confidential note below.

board note of bawep-tajef: Queniusek Systems plans to raise the Quenvan list price by 53.1 percent in March. The pricing group signed off on a budget of $176.4 million for Project Drueth. The renewal with Casionix Partners closes at $142.5 million a year, 8.3 percent below the last contract. Project Fraax slips by six weeks because of the tooling delay.

Plugin authors have reported that the Feedproof validator accepts enclosure types in the sandbox that it rejects in production. Root cause: the sandbox config was hand-edited during the Maribel release and never synced back. Until the environments are reconciled, treat production behavior as canonical — if your plugin passes in sandbox but fails live, this drift is the likely reason. We are pinning both environments to a single source next sprint. The production values your plugins should validate against are listed below.

settings of kajep-kajop:
OLIDOR_LOG_LEVEL=info
OLIDOR_METRICS_HOST=metrics.olidor.norvacorp.corp
OLIDOR_POOL_SIZE=4

**Step 2: Hook your plugin into the farm**

Welcome, plugin folks! Before Renderstampede will accept jobs from your transcoder plugin, you need to register it against the farm scheduler. Run `stampede plugin register --name yours` and grab the worker slot it assigns — don't hardcode the slot number, it changes between farm rebuilds. Your plugin authenticates to the job queue with a credential the scheduler hands back at registration. Drop it into the `.env` file next to your plugin manifest, one line:

sealed setting: RELAY_SECRET13=bca49b02a6971